Position: Senior .NET Developer
Location: Porto, Hybrid
Position Overview:
As a Senior .NET Developer at Nimber, you will play a crucial role in the development and maintenance of our platform. You will work closely with our product and design teams to understand business requirements and translate them into efficient and scalable code. You will also be responsible for mentoring and guiding junior developers, contributing to code reviews, and continuously improving our development processes.
Key Responsibilities:
- Design, develop, and maintain efficient and scalable .NET-based applications
- Collaborate with product and design teams to understand business requirements and translate them into technical solutions
- Mentor and guide junior developers, providing technical leadership and ensuring high-quality code
- Conduct code reviews and participate in team discussions to continuously improve our development processes
- Troubleshoot and debug issues in a timely manner
- Keep up-to-date with industry trends and best practices, and proactively suggest improvements to our technology stack
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field
- 5+ years of experience in .NET development, with a strong understanding of C# and ASP.NET
- Experience with web development frameworks such as Angular, React, or Vue
- Knowledge of SQL and database design principles
- Familiarity with Agile/Scrum methodologies
- Excellent problem-solving and critical thinking skills
- Strong communication and collaboration skills
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ced environment
